WHAT YOU WILL DO:    
  • Compose and capture live gameplay with player perspective cameras or using detached cameras. 
  • Work in the Unreal Engine 5 editor as needed to overcome technical issues. 
  • Become familiar with in-production titles and update game builds on a weekly basis. 
  • Edit string-outs or short form content in both a supervised and unsupervised capacity.  
  • Generate shot lists based on creative briefs, pitch decks, and editorial string outs.  
  • Work closely with creative directors, producers, and marketing executives to ensure creative vision is achieved.  
  • Report and communicate gameplay issues/bugs to development teams and the creative services team.  
  • Coordinate delivery of produced content for distribution on acceptable channels.
